💨 Abstract
Jammu and Kashmir BJP president, Ravinder Raina, voted in the second phase of elections in his constituency, Nowshera, expressing confidence in the party's victory. He emphasized the people's vote for peace, progress, and development under the Modi government. Raina faces a significant challenge from a former party colleague contesting on a National Conference ticket.
